diff --git a/doc/source/command-objects/network-meter-rule.rst b/doc/source/command-objects/network-meter-rule.rst index 83f8fd4fb4..22d50aa907 100644 --- a/doc/source/command-objects/network-meter-rule.rst +++ b/doc/source/command-objects/network-meter-rule.rst @@ -18,18 +18,16 @@ Create meter rule .. code:: bash openstack network meter rule create - [--project [--project-domain ]] + --remote-ip-prefix [--ingress | --egress] [--exclude | --include] - --remote-ip-prefix + [--project [--project-domain ]] .. option:: --project Owner's project (name or ID) - *Network version 2 only* - .. option:: --project-domain Domain the project belongs to (name of ID). diff --git a/doc/source/command-objects/server.rst b/doc/source/command-objects/server.rst index f18d091855..a5d22f81c2 100644 --- a/doc/source/command-objects/server.rst +++ b/doc/source/command-objects/server.rst @@ -117,11 +117,16 @@ Create a new server .. option:: --image - Create server from this image (name or ID) + Create server boot disk from this image (name or ID) .. option:: --volume - Create server from this volume (name or ID) + Create server using this volume as the boot disk (name or ID) + + This option automatically creates a block device mapping with a boot + index of 0. On many hypervisors (libvirt/kvm for example) this will + be device ``vda``. Do not create a duplicate mapping using + :option:`--block-device-mapping` for this volume. .. option:: --flavor diff --git a/openstackclient/compute/v2/server.py b/openstackclient/compute/v2/server.py index ccda1c519b..f9f0df4f2f 100644 --- a/openstackclient/compute/v2/server.py +++ b/openstackclient/compute/v2/server.py @@ -336,12 +336,15 @@ class CreateServer(command.ShowOne): disk_group.add_argument( '--image', metavar='', - help=_('Create server from this image (name or ID)'), + help=_('Create server boot disk from this image (name or ID)'), ) disk_group.add_argument( '--volume', metavar='', - help=_('Create server from this volume (name or ID)'), + help=_( + 'Create server using this volume as the boot disk ' + '(name or ID)' + ), ) parser.add_argument( '--flavor', diff --git a/releasenotes/notes/bp-neutron-client-metering-6f8f9527c2a797fd.yaml b/releasenotes/notes/bp-neutron-client-metering-6f8f9527c2a797fd.yaml new file mode 100644 index 0000000000..37ecdcb8de --- /dev/null +++ b/releasenotes/notes/bp-neutron-client-metering-6f8f9527c2a797fd.yaml @@ -0,0 +1,7 @@ +--- +features: + - | + Add meter rules commands for ``network meter rule create``, + ``network meter rule delete``, ``network meter rule list``, + and ``network meter rule show``. + [Blueprint :oscbp:`neutron-client-metering`] diff --git a/releasenotes/notes/support-no-property-in-volume-snapshot-0af3fcb31a3cfc2b.yaml b/releasenotes/notes/support-no-property-in-volume-snapshot-0af3fcb31a3cfc2b.yaml index 6a3220b248..42e06179b4 100644 --- a/releasenotes/notes/support-no-property-in-volume-snapshot-0af3fcb31a3cfc2b.yaml +++ b/releasenotes/notes/support-no-property-in-volume-snapshot-0af3fcb31a3cfc2b.yaml @@ -2,6 +2,4 @@ features: - | Add ``--no-property`` option in ``volume snapshot set``. - Supporting ``--no-property`` option will apply user a convenient way to - clean all properties of volume snapshot in a short command. - [ Blueprint `allow-overwrite-set-options ` _] + [Blueprint `allow-overwrite-set-options `_]